Output 1661fec0fac89d3d5d0e611ed78d7f656b39451daea1d8be2411cde4ba13cb3a:0

value
23945575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35572a09072ae3e904f4cec0ff84ca10cf3ab712 OP_EQUAL
address
36Z49z7isY48gxnAi6vCgh5JX2eFZh29Q2
transaction
1661fec0fac89d3d5d0e611ed78d7f656b39451daea1d8be2411cde4ba13cb3a
spent
true